EDITORS COMMENTS
Study Geometry Sorbonne 1886-87 captures the essence of intellectual pursuit and artistic mastery. This fabric print, rendered in a deep black crayon, showcases the meticulous attention to detail by Pierre Puvis de Chavannes, a renowned French artist from Lyons. The focal point of this artwork is a youthful and pensive figure standing amidst squared blue lines that symbolize the study of geometry. The drawing stands as a part of an allegory, reflecting Puvis' great mural masterpieces painted between 1887 and 1889 for the newly rebuilt lecture hall at Sorbonne University in Paris. Measuring at 10 x 6 7/8 inches (254 x 175 cm), this piece exemplifies Puvis' skillful technique and his ability to convey emotion through simple yet powerful imagery. The use of fabricated black crayon adds depth and texture to the composition, enhancing its visual impact.
